Understanding the Mechanics of Predictive Markets

Predictive markets, at their core, operate on the principle of information aggregation. The price of a contract on a platform like kalshi reflects the collective belief of all participants regarding the probability of a specific event occurring. When more people believe an event is likely, the price of the contract increases, and vice-versa. This isn’t based on hope or opinion alone; it's driven by individuals willing to put their money where their mouths are. Traders are incentivized to be accurate in their predictions, as profitability depends on correctly anticipating the outcome.

The process involves buying and selling “yes” or “no” contracts. A “yes” contract will pay out $1.00 if the event occurs, while a “no” contract will pay out $1.00 if the event does not occur. The price of these contracts fluctuates between $0.00 and $1.00, representing the market’s implied probability. Participants attempt to profit by buying low and selling high, or vice versa, based on their assessment of the event's likelihood. This creates a continuous flow of information into the price, making it a dynamic and responsive indicator. The efficiency of these markets often surpasses traditional methods of forecasting, as they incorporate a wide range of insights and expertise.

How Liquidity Impacts Market Accuracy

Liquidity is a critical component of a well-functioning predictive market. Higher liquidity, or the ease with which contracts can be bought and sold, generally leads to more accurate price discovery. When a market is liquid, there are numerous buyers and sellers, ensuring that prices reflect the latest available information. Conversely, low liquidity can lead to price manipulation and a less reliable signal. Factors influencing liquidity include the popularity of the event being predicted, the number of active participants on the platform, and the overall trading volume. A market with limited liquidity is vulnerable to large trades that can significantly distort the price, rendering it a less accurate reflection of collective belief.

Increased liquidity promotes tighter bid-ask spreads, decreasing transaction costs and encouraging more participation. This further refines the price discovery process, enhancing the market’s predictive capabilities. Platforms like kalshi actively work to promote liquidity through various mechanisms, such as market maker programs and incentives for traders. Understanding the role of liquidity is essential for both participants and observers of predictive markets, as it directly impacts the reliability and value of the information gleaned from price movements.

The Regulatory Landscape of Predictive Markets

Historically, predictive markets have operated in a grey area from a regulatory standpoint. Concerns surrounding gambling laws and potential manipulation led to uncertainty and limited growth. However, recent developments, particularly the regulatory framework adopted by the Commodity Futures Trading Commission (CFTC) in the United States, have paved the way for legitimate, regulated platforms to emerge. This regulatory clarity is crucial for fostering trust and attracting institutional investors to the space.

The CFTC’s approach focuses on establishing rules for contract design, trading practices, and dispute resolution, aiming to ensure fair and transparent markets. This doesn’t eliminate risk entirely; predictive markets still inherently involve uncertainty. However, it provides a level of protection for participants and offers a more stable environment for market development. The evolution of regulation has been a key factor in the growth and legitimization of these platforms, attracting more participants and enhancing their integrity.

The Role of the CFTC in Oversight

The Commodity Futures Trading Commission (CFTC) has taken the lead in regulating predictive markets in the US, granting designated contract markets (DCMs) the authority to list these types of contracts. This oversight actively seeks to minimize risks associated with fraud and manipulation. The CFTC’s regulatory framework emphasizes transparency, requiring platforms to disclose information about their operations, contract terms, and trading activity. Additionally, the CFTC enforces rules against insider trading and other prohibited practices, offering protection for market participants.

Furthermore, the CFTC’s involvement helps to establish a clear legal framework for dispute resolution. This creates confidence among traders and investors, encouraging greater participation in the market. The regulatory oversight provided by the CFTC is critical for the long-term sustainability and credibility of predictive markets, transforming their landscape from speculation into a legitimate form of market forecasting.

Applications Beyond Political Forecasting

While often associated with predicting election outcomes, the applications of predictive markets extend far beyond the political sphere. Businesses are increasingly utilizing these platforms to forecast sales, assess the success of new products, and gauge market sentiment. Supply chain managers can leverage predictive markets to anticipate disruptions and optimize inventory levels. The ability to aggregate diverse insights and generate accurate forecasts provides a significant competitive advantage in various industries.

In the realm of finance, predictive markets can be used to forecast economic indicators, such as inflation rates or unemployment figures. This information can be valuable for investors making asset allocation decisions. Even in scientific research, predictive markets can be employed to forecast the outcomes of clinical trials or assess the likelihood of scientific breakthroughs. The versatility of this technology makes it a powerful tool for anyone seeking to improve their forecasting accuracy.

Predictive Markets in Corporate Strategy

Corporations are beginning to recognize the power of predictive markets for internal forecasting and strategic decision-making. By creating internal markets, companies can tap into the collective intelligence of their employees to predict future events relevant to their business. This can include forecasting sales figures, predicting customer demand, or assessing the risks associated with new ventures. The key advantage of this approach is that it leverages the diverse knowledge and expertise within the organization, providing a more accurate and nuanced forecast than traditional methods.

Furthermore, internal predictive markets can foster a culture of accountability and data-driven decision-making. Employees are incentivized to contribute accurate predictions, as their performance can be linked to the outcomes of the markets. This promotes a greater understanding of the factors driving business performance and encourages more informed decision-making across the organization. Utilizing predictive markets internally isn’t merely a forecasting tool, but a technique to create a more agile and informed company culture.

Exploring the Intersection with Scenario Planning

Predictive markets offer a parallel, and potentially complementary, strategy to traditional scenario planning exercises employed by businesses and governments. While scenario planning involves constructing detailed narratives of potential future events, predictive markets establish a quantifiable, real-time assessment of probabilities. The beauty of combining these approaches lies in the ability to validate and refine scenarios through market signals. If a scenario is consistently priced as highly improbable by the market, it prompts a re-evaluation of the underlying assumptions and potential biases in the scenario's construction. Perhaps a vital factor was overlooked, or the likelihood of a specific trigger event was overestimated. This iterative process enhances the robustness and realism of the overall strategic outlook. Consider a corporation outlining potential responses to shifts in geopolitical landscapes; a predictive market gauging the likelihood of those shifts offers a tangible gauge of perceived risk and allows for more focused contingency plans. It’s a practical application of harnessing collective intelligence to create a more agile and adaptable strategy.

Furthermore, predictive markets can highlight blind spots or unforeseen consequences within otherwise meticulously crafted scenarios. The wisdom of the crowd often captures nuances and interdependencies that traditional modelling might miss. By continuously monitoring market prices, organizations gain access to an early warning system for emerging threats and opportunities—a dynamic form of intelligence that fuels proactive decision-making. This intersection of predictive markets and scenario planning isn't about replacing established methods; it's about augmenting them with a data-driven, market-validated layer of insight. The result is a more informed, resilient, and forward-looking approach to navigating an increasingly complex world.
